Convert An Android App To Ios: Steps To Porting Code & Interface

This offers you with a greater time-to-market for your small business. ” is simple — your product have to be introduced on totally different operating systems. In Any Other Case, you artificially reduce your viewers, thus decreasing your earnings. When you port an Android app to iOS, you open new markets and get entry to the viewers that’s used to paying for the software program often.

This step ensures that delicate user knowledge is protected on both Android and iOS platforms. Confirm that each one functionalities of your app work flawlessly on iOS. This includes testing features, buttons, varieties, and any other interactive components. Functional testing ensures that users on iOS can take pleasure in the same set of features as on the Android version.

Convert An Android App To Ios Or Vice Versa: 4-step Process & Tech Specifications

The Android system supports totally different display screen resolutions, which is sufficient to cowl the primary 5-7 sizes. The system also adapts the application to essentially the most applicable dimension by itself and resembles screens properly on Android phones. The solely exception to this process is the case in case your app just isn’t developed cross-platform initially. This is hybrid app working with both operating systems whereas utilizing a range of web-based libraries and frameworks.

how to port android app to ios

However, if your finances is proscribed and also you can’t afford to construct separate apps from scratch however still need to expand your market, it’s potential to convert Android apps to iOS. Other essential things in regards to the person interface to think about embody a quantity of small however important parts of design, corresponding to sliders, navigation bars, etc https://www.globalcloudteam.com/. Oftentimes, a cellular app makes use of third-party integrations and libraries. Hence, you will want to be certain that your system is suitable with these external options. If they aren’t supported in iOS, then you must search for alternate options. Make certain any adjustments within the code do not trigger new bugs after the app is converted.

On common, it takes from several months to several years – virtually so lengthy as developing an app from scratch. It’s crucial to make a transformed software as user-friendly and convenient as it was. To make it appropriately builders want to consider many parameters. Relying on the type of your app, there may be other reasons as properly.

how to port android app to ios

Causes For Converting An Android App To Ios Or Vice Versa

  • This is why retaining the services of professional Android to iOS app developers is important.
  • Individuals utilizing Android units can tab the Back button to go to the previous display screen, however there is not a such button available on iOS gadgets.
  • This is because Android makes use of XML technology for information sharing.
  • Move to iOS can be required for WhatsApp’s chat switch perform when transferring chats from Android to iOS.

It is best to arrange high-quality layouts for mobile working techniques in advance when converting your Android app to iOS or vice versa. This strategy makes use of the command-line software that transforms Java code to Objective-C, a programming language for building native iOS functions. Google created J2ObjC as a sort of open-source Android to iOS converter to assist devs in source code porting. When we say converter, it does not imply that you could addContent purposes into some sort of software program, click “convert,” and wait whereas it transforms the file into the specified format. Unfortunately, there aren’t any such instruments, and any type of changing APK to iOS requires an experienced developer to work with the supply code, however J2ObjC can make the process simpler.

Double testing to make sure converted characteristics are working fine. It will get cheap to make your product suitable with probably the most prevalent OS versions. If the testing phase is skipped or shortened due to a scarcity of price range the user will get a raw product with typical bugs. If the user isn’t how to convert android app to ios satisfied with the product, he stops using it and goes to the opponents, choosing the competing product. As a rule, QA processes take up to 30% of all the development cycle time.

Usually, iOS apps have both horizontal and vertical elements, while Android apps have an abundance of vertical elements. So when you’re growing the clone counterpart of your Android App for iOS, make sure to take further care of these elements. Nicely, Android and iOS make the most of totally different monetization models, and the way much profit you generate depends machine learning totally on the model you’ve picked. Anyway, two apps usually have a tendency to deliver extra income than one. If you want to go international and increase your App to a quantity of new markets, you have to supply two totally different apps for Android and iOS.

The conversion process requires proficiency in both Android and iOS growth, deep technical abilities, and knowledge of the most effective tools for code reuse. Reaching out to an skilled mobile app improvement companies provider ensures that your app’s design, performance, and functionality are preserved and performance validly. This is as a result of native components within the operating systems which every platform has. Native Android or iOS app improvement requires utilizing different programming languages, design interfaces, navigation, and integration course of. All these elements should adjust to a specific working system and work seamlessly both on an iOS or Android phone. From time to time Apple and Google builders make changes to working methods, bettering the interface, security, and so forth.

Variations Of Working Systems

Given the fragmentation of the Android ecosystem, nevertheless, many Android devices stay vulnerable. Now, researchers are revealing that, for years, the mitigations have suffered from a fundamental defect that has made them trivial to bypass. For extra environment friendly app testing, think about making use of the most recent strategies and utilizing real cellular units and console log. Even you may also search help from a dependable automation testing firm. Individuals utilizing Android devices can tab the Again button to go to the earlier display, but there is no such button out there on iOS units.

There’s no have to develop the mockups and adjust the app for all 20+ display screen resolutions for Android. Simply decide 5-7 mostly used resolutions and the system will do all the changes on its own. Of course, the listing of variations just isn’t limited to the screen sizes and resolutions but these factors should be handled exactly. If you ask us what metaphor can be used, we would decide the method of constructing the house.

Usually, a talented iOS developer knows all the ins and outs of what Apple expects from the new iOS apps. In this blog submit, we will talk about the nuances of tips on how to convert an Android app to iOS and the steps this process consists of. Converting your current app on Android to iOS involves recreating the app in Swift or Objective-C and adapting it to fit iOS guidelines. Another vital issue is the placement and tech savviness of your improvement team.

Forgiveness is when users of an utility can make predictable errors. Many customers of purposes complain about conditions after they press the incorrect button and lose all their outcomes. Nevertheless, our staff develops logos and patterns based mostly on developments and marketing, however still following the overall design idea.

Leave a Comment

Your email address will not be published. Required fields are marked *